HENDERSON, Ky (WEHT) – Kentucky Governor Andy Beshear announced funding to enhance Kentucky’s riverports and increase economic opportunities to the tune of almost $2.3 million.
Over $500,000 of that is going to Henderson County and Owensboro.

According to a release, the Henderson County Riverport Authority was awarded over $320,000 to replace a mobile conveyor system with a new electric material handler.
The Owensboro Riverport Authority won two awards totaling more than $200,000 to purchase a new yard tractor and a new forklift.
